weird noise from engine area

I have a weird noise coming from the engine area of my 2000 f350 srw 4x4 150,000 mile truck. It makes a popping noise very similiar to a gas engine popping through the carburetor.It does not do it all the time. The engine appears to be running normally and no lights have come on in the dash.Any ideas? thanks

Have you climbed under the truck near the motor compartment area at all and checked things out ?? Not so much ticking but I had clunking noises and it turned out to be my swaybar bushings. Does it do it more on bumpy roads?? As for the ticking, any soot around the exhaust manifolds?? If you got a ticking theres a chance you might have an exhaust leak.

Slip yoke

Have you ever greased your slip yoke? Almost sounds like it is banging when you take the load off of it, easy fix, and it is common.
